Method for providing targeted profile interactive CATV
displays

Abstract

The present invention relates to an interactive communication system,
such as an interactive cable television system (10), for providing an
interactive information output over a common output channel from a
plurality of remotely transmitted different information inputs (22, 24, 26,
28, 30) and, more particularly, relates to an improved method for
interactively creating a selection profile for a subscriber and interactively
selecting in real time one of a plurality of messages, such as television
commercials or game scores, based upon the selection profile whereby
multiple users of a one-way television signal distribution network (60)
may obtain an individualized or tailored program information content for
a television programming sequence. The selection profile may be created
in advance of transmission of the television program or commercial or
during transmission of a given program and may be varied from the head
end. In this manner, highly tailored information may be provided to
particular subscribers based on their individual profiles as recognized by
the system. In addition, selection profiles comprising subsets of a group
of parameters may also be created with the tailored programming based
on the subsets as well.
